4. Implementation Philosophy: Paywall vs. LMS vs. Flexibility
Your business type dictates the best foundation. Do not force an LMS onto a simple paywall, or vice versa.
Focus: Restriction and Transactions
These tools exist purely to draw hard lines around content. **MemberPress** provides a complete solution, including registration, protection, and dunning, making it ideal for the affiliate who wants a single tool to handle everything. **RCP** offers a cleaner, more modular approach, appealing to marketers who want to pick and choose integrations without the bloat. Both are robust and offer superior MRR reporting.
Focus: Customization and Code Control
**Paid Memberships Pro (PMP)** is highly valued by developers because its open-source core means it can be customized endlessly. This is great for unique pay models that the bigger tools do not support natively. **WishList Member** is an older, legacy system known for its robust protection of specific content files and multi-level access rules, though its UI often feels dated compared to the newer options. These are for complex, non-standard restriction needs.
Focus: Course Progression and Enrollment
LearnDash's native group and payment features are excellent if **course access** is the primary value proposition. It handles membership as an entitlement to a course, not just content access. However, its core dunning and payment recovery features are weak; you must rely entirely on the integrated payment gateway (e.g., Stripe's features) or a third-party add-on to manage failed payments.
5. Trade-Offs and The Final Verdict for Affiliates
My recommendation is rooted in the platform's ability to protect the revenue stream.
RCP: Clean Code, Clean Revenue
The Trade-Off: Less "all-in-one" than MemberPress. For advanced features like affiliate link management or complex e-commerce, you will definitely be buying extra add-ons.
Verdict: **Best for Affiliates who prioritize simplicity** and want a beautiful, easy-to-manage member experience. It is lightweight and integrates cleanly with popular tools.
LearnDash: The Content Specialist
The Trade-Off: Its core focus is education. Trying to use it to restrict blog posts, custom post types, or specific affiliate landing pages can be cumbersome compared to dedicated paywall plugins.
Verdict: **Essential for course creators.** Use it to manage course enrollment and content dripping, but consider pairing it with a stronger tool if you need highly granular, non-LMS content protection.
